Mini-Abstract We report the case of a neonate presented with respiratory distress and severe cardiomegaly. Two-dimensional echocardiography revealed tethering of tricuspid valve with severe regurgitation. We used real time three-dimensional echocardiography to clarify the mechanism of this regurgitation.
